So many venues, each with their own unique vistas. If we say Plas Maenen, North Wales wedding venue in the Conwy Valley is definitley one of a kind, we wouldn’t be exaggerating! It’s stunning views of the valley are on the ‘Mach Loop’ flight training path for RAF Valley on Anglesey. Midweek weddings are often treated to a flypast from a variety of aircraft. What if it rains when we planned an outdoor wedding ceremony??
Well, this is Britain….. No matter how many sausages we bury, sometimes the sun just doesn’t come out to play. Your venue will always have one eye on the weather forecast. They will do their absolute best to help you have the outdoor ceremony you hoped for. A final decision will be taken about an hour before the planned ceremony time, in case they have to set up indoors as a backup plan for you. Afterall, getting married is the most important thing.
A perfect example of ‘weather watching’ for this beautiful couple at their wedding. The staff at Albright Hussey Shropshire wedding venue bent over backwards in distinctly ‘changeable’ weather. The planned ceremony time was greeted with a thunderstorm! One of the huge benefits of having a celebrant led wedding is that they can be so much more flexible with their time. After everyone sheltered inside from the rain, the sun shone fantastically for the ceremony they worked so hard for.
